Cleaning Flywheel
 
I'm going to be installing a FW for my Integra this weekend. I got some oil, grease, and finger prints on the FW. Just wondering if brake cleaner is the recommended cleaner?

Not sure if it leaves a residue. So brake cleaner? Mineral spirits?

mad0953 12-18-2008 05:02 PM

If I were doing it I would rub it with some real fine steel wool and either lacquer thinner or acetone.

y8s 12-18-2008 05:17 PM

brake cleaner works great. flywheels and brake rotors are pretty much brothers.

kotomile 12-18-2008 07:55 PM

Yup brake cleaner. FYI it leaves no residue, unlike carb cleaner.
